Application
N-Boc-aniline is widely utilized in research focused on:
Pharmaceutical Development: This compound serves as a key intermediate in the synthesis of various pharmaceuticals, particularly in the development of drugs targeting neurological disorders.
Organic Synthesis: It is commonly used in organic chemistry for the protection of amines during multi-step synthesis, allowing for more complex molecules to be created without unwanted reactions.
Material Science: N-Boc-aniline is employed in the production of polymers and resins, enhancing properties such as thermal stability and mechanical strength in materials used in coatings and adhesives.
Bioconjugation: This chemical plays a significant role in bioconjugation processes, facilitating the attachment of biomolecules to surfaces or other molecules, which is crucial in the development of biosensors and drug delivery systems.
Research and Development: It is frequently utilized in academic and industrial laboratories for the synthesis of novel compounds, aiding researchers in exploring new chemical reactions and applications.
